N256 YOV is a 1996 Rover 420 in Blue with a 1,994cc petrol engine. This vehicle has been through 10 MOT tests with a personal pass rate of 50%.

Across all 1996 Rover 420 models, the average MOT pass rate is 61.8% with a typical mileage of 99,613 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.

The most common reason a Rover 420 fails its MOT is constant velocity joint gaiter split, accounting for 35,342 recorded failures. If you're considering buying N256 YOV, it's worth having these areas checked by a mechanic before committing.

The Rover 420 typically stays on UK roads for around 33 years. At 30 years old, this Rover 420 is approaching the upper end of the typical lifespan for this model.
